The Creative Toolbox: Applying creative tools to teaching and learning
Duration 1 day
Team Professional Development

 Who should attend?

Anyone working in HE who is interested in developing their creativity to improve their teaching. This includes new and experienced colleagues.

Course Description:

By using the narrative structure and developing springboard stories, participants will see how they can improve their professional performance, and problem solving skills. They will be given a range of creative tools that they can apply to the workplace and use to improve teaching and learning. This session is hands on, practical, and fun.

Learning Outcomes:

By the end of this workshop you will be able to:

  • Apply creative tools to teaching and learning;
  • Develop springboard tales for problem solving;
  • Improve your personal and professional confidence.

 Course Tutor:

Alison Davies is an experienced trainer and creative practitioner. An author of thirteen books on a range of subjects and a professional storyteller. Alison delivers workshops for both the public and private sector throughout the UK. She has been involved in a number of ground-breaking projects using narratives, in particular working with the law school at Leicester University and delivering seminars using storytelling and presentation techniques as part of legal ethics seminars. She also writes for a selection of magazines, newspapers and educational journals. Her goal is to encourage a creative approach in all aspects of teaching and learning.
